WILLIAM STRONG
William L. "Bill" Strong, 64, of Eureka, died Monday, September 22, 2003, at his home in Eureka.

He was born July 16, 1939, at Strong City, the son of Truman and Opal Wilson Strong.

He is survived by his parents, Truman and Opal Strong of Great Bend; a companion, Lela Hodgens and her children, Omar Hodgens of El Dorado, Jole Palmer of Reading, Kay Tucker of El Dorado; nine grandchildren; nine great-grandchildren; a brother, Dean Strong of Lindsborg; and a sister, Neva Hayes of Castle Rock, Colo.

DORIS WEST
Doris Marie West, 72, of Boonville, Mo., died Monday, September 15, 2003, at her home.

She was born on February 28, 1931, in Harper, the daughter of Fred and Marie (Stanfield) Hamm.

She is survived by her husband; two sons, Bob West of Columbia, David West of Concordia, Mo.; one daughter, Marcy Grammer of Macon, Mo.; one sister, Maxine Russell of Eureka; one brother, Fred Hamm of Butler, Mo., and nine grandchildren.

MAX SHINKLE

Max Edward Shinkle, 80, a resident of rural Fall River, died Sunday, February 1, 2004, at Via Christi St. Francis Medical Center in Wichita.

He was born October 22, 1923, at Fall River, the son of Edward Everett and Artelia Bell (McReynold) Shinkle.

He is survived by stepson, George Speer of Fall River; stepdaughter, Jeanie Scheck of Wichita; brother, Larry Joe Shinkle of Wichita; sister, Bessie Hime of Fall River; thirteen nephews and fifteen nieces.

CECIL HAUN

Cecil Melvin Haun, 93, of rural Coyville, died Wednesday, March 31, 2004, at Beverly Health and Rehab in Fredonia.

He was born on February 26, 1911, in Parkerville, the son of Melvin and Maude (Kendall) Haun.

He is survived by his wife, Iva of the home; one son, Cecil D. Haun of Fall River; three daughters, Marilyn Trimmell of Wichita, Judy Fritz of Midwest City, Okla. and Bettysue Kerlin of Huntsville, Ala.; one sister, Frances Smith of Parkerville; eleven grandchildren and 19 great-grandchildren.

Funeral services were held April 3, at the Timmons Funeral Home Chapel.

IRENE CUTMYER

Irene Cutmyer, 91, of Eureka, died Sunday, May 23, 2004 at Medicalodge of Eureka.

She was born in Greenwood County, the daughter of William Tyler and Maude (Clopton) Meredith.

She is survived by one son, William Cutmyer of Pittsburg, Calif.

Memorial services were held Friday, May 28, 2004.

DORTHA DODD
Dortha Pauline Dodd was born on January 7, 1915, at Cherryvale, the daughter of Rena Dortha (McMahill) and Fred Alexander Hurd.

She is survived by one daughter, Dortha Ann Roberts of Houston, Texas; two grandsons Ryan Dodd Roberts and Michael Edward Roberts of Dallas, Texas; one sister, Fredda Weddle and two nephews.

Funeral services were held Friday, May 28, 2004.

RAYMOND HAMMOND

Raymond Lloyd Hammond, 74, of Eureka, died Tuesday, August 3, 2004, at Via Christi - St. Francis in Wichita.

He was born on November 18, 1929, in Burlington, the son of Arza and Emma (Williams) Hammond. He was raised near Burlington and attended Coffey County rural schools.

He is survived by four sons, Keith Hammond of Neosho Falls, Curtis Hammond of Fritch, Texas, Lloyd Hammond of Moran; two daughters, Connie Houck of Moran, Pamela Mann of Pryor, Okla.; 14 grandchildren; numerous great-grandchildren and two brothers, Charles Hammond of Emporia and Leo Hammond of Colorado.

Funeral services were held Friday, August 6, 2004, at the Koup Family Funeral Home.

ELMER J. THOLE
Elmer J. Thole, age 84, born April 19, 1920, in McCook, Nebraska and died August 8, 2004, in Greenwood County Hospital in Eureka, Kansas.

He served our country in World War II, in the European Theatre from April 13, 1944 to January 31, 1946, as a combat engineer.

His survivors include a loving wife of 39 years, Opal A. Thole, Fall River, KS; sister, Violet Pennington, Oklahoma City, OK.; daughter, Barbara Taylor, Bartlesville, OK; son, Jerry Thole, Fall River, KS.; Ron Thole, Derby, KS; Todd Plummer, Rose Hill, KS.; daughter, Janice Smith, Bartlesville, OK.; daughter, Vicki Dixon, Naples, FL.; son, Norman Thole, Fall River, KS.; Sister-in-laws, Thelma Thole, Wichita, KS; Polly Thole, New Burn, NC., Brother, Willis Nigh, Wichita, KS.; brother Sid Showalter, Tucson, AZ.; 24 great-grandchildren and one great-great- grandchild.

Services are Thursday, August 12, at 11 a.m., at Koup Family Funeral Home.

GUY SHUMARD

Guy Myrl Shumard, 85, died Sunday, August 8, 2004, at the Greenwood County Hospital in Eureka.

He was born in rural Eureka on February 23, 1919, the son of Harvey and Gertrude (Rader) Shumard.

He is survived by his wife, Harriet, of the home.

Funeral services will be held at 10 a.m., Friday, August 13, 2004, at the Christian and Congregational Church.

EARL SUTTER
Earl C. Sutter, 87, of Eureka, died Wednesday, August 4, 2004, at Medicalodge of Eureka.

He was born in Kieley, on April 2, 1917, the son of Theodore and Lula (Harris) Sutter.

He is survived by his wife, Ida, of the home, three sons, Jack Sutter of Rosalia, Raymond Sutter of Wichita and William Sutter of Cape Girardeau, Mo.; one step-son, Ronald Powell of Eureka; two step-daughters, Patricia Richey and Karen Richey both of Wichita; twelve grandchildren, fifteen step-grandchildren, nine great-grandchildren, 12 step-great-grandchildren, four great-great-grandchildren and two step-great-great-grandchildren.

Memorial services were held Wednesday, August 11, 2004, at the Bible Baptist Church.

DORIS THORNTON
Doris Dee Thornton, 77, of Eureka, died Tuesday, August 3, 2004, at the Greenwood County Hospital.

She was born September 15, 1926, in Eureka, the daughter of Ernest and Leilia (Jones) Lozier.

She is survived by three sons, David Thornton, Donald Thornton and Kenneth Thornton, all of Eureka; one daughter, Joyce Pearse of Eureka; 12 grandchildren; 10 great-grandchildren and one brother, Robert Lozier of Eureka.

Graveside services and intermenty was held Thursday, August 5, in Greenwood Cemetery.

JOHN WINN
John Forest Winn, 90, died Sunday, August 8, 2004, at Greenwood County Hospital in Eureka.

He was born in northeast Butler County on May 25, 1914, the son of John S. and Irene (Paulson) Winn.

He is survived by one sister, Hazel Winn and one brother, Harold Winn, both of Eureka.

Funeral services were held Wednesday, August 11, 2004, at Koup Family Funeral Home.

KENNETH ALFORD

Kenneth Duane Alford, 70, of Eureka, died Sunday, November 28, 2004, at Greenwood County Hospital.

He was born on December 3, 1933, in Peru, the son of Ralph and Dorothy (Chrisman) Alford.

He is survived by his wife, Mary of the home; three sons, Rocky Alford of Garnett, Joe Alford of Xanten-Marianbaum, Germany and Jack Alford of Eureka; two daughters, Debbie Plew and Rhonda Bartel, both of Mulvane; twelve grandchildren; two great-grandchildren; one brother, Gerald Alford of Independence and two sisters, Phyllis Alford and Janet Alford, both of Bartlesville, Okla.

Funeral services were held Thursday, December 2, at Koup Family Funeral Home.

WILLIAM BOBBIT
William E. "Eddie" Bobbitt, 89, of Eureka, died Friday, November 26, 2004 in Eureka.

He was born May 13, 1915, the fourth child of Fred and Pauline (Denner) Bobbitt.

He is survived by his wife, sister, Margaret Hale of Eureka and several nieces and nephews.

Funeral services were held Tuesday, November 30, at Koup Family Funeral Home.
